The Influences Of Wheat Potassium-releasing Bacteria On Growth And Nutrient Uptake Of Wheat Seedlings

The aim of this paper is to investigate the influence of wheat potassium releasing bacteria on growth、root、nutrients utilization and soil biological activities.The effects of11 affinity potassium-releasing bacteria on the ground part and root of wheat with methods such as semi-solid test and root bag test by testing 8 indicators including root tips 、 surface area 、 volume,etc.The pot experiments were applied to investigate the effects of the 11 strains on the absorption of fertilizer of wheat.In the semi-solid test and root bag test,the results reflected that the strains tested had significantly effects on the growth of wheat seedlings,6 strains of them can promote the development of root system and dry weight of ground part which can benefit the establishment of the root morphology.In two pot experiments,we collected the soil samples to test the content ofavailable potassium and available phosphorus,the results indicated that the conte nt of available potassium were lower than CK2,the control group of 100% potassi um fertilizer application.By testing the accumulation of available potassium and available phosphorus of the ground part,we found that the accumulation of available phosphorus treated with strains tested were higher than that of control group in seedling stage;10 strains made the accumulation of available potassium of ground part treated with WS25、WS27、WS28were higher than that of CK2,especially strain WS27 significantly promoted the seedlings potassium accumulation of wheat.By investing the activities of the activities of invertase,as well as the alka line phosphatase and urease of soil,we found that 6 strains made the the invertas e higher than that of CK1,especially strains WS16 significantly promoted the activ ities of invertase than that of CK2;the activities of alkaline phosphatase treated with 5 strains were higher than the control group,and the activities of urease of soil treated with 6 strains tested were higher than that of CK2,especially strain WS20、WS22、WS27 significantly promoted the activities of urease of soil.Considering the results above,the content of nutrient of soil and the results of seedling potassium accumulation,we got a conclusion about the balance of fertilizer and we found that the wheat potassium releasing bacterium tested can slow down the potassium and phosphorus fixed,they can promote the content of nutrient of ground patwhich wheat can absorb directly.The wheat potassium releasing bacteria tested in this paper were proved to be beneficial promote the utilization and absorption of soil nutrient,they can improve the recovery efficiency(RE)of fertilizer and promote the growth 、 development of wheat.These results can provide theory basis for researching the mechanism of action of the potassium bacterium,they can also make a contribution to developing the microbial fertilizer.
